The Madison Roam Stretch Shorts are designed for adult female mountain bikers who demand a versatile garment that transitions seamlessly from technical trail riding to casual social settings. These shorts provide the key benefit of high-performance 4-way stretch fabric and water-repellent protection without the bulk of traditional baggy cycling gear. While they offer excellent mobility and secure storage, users should note that they are unpadded, meaning they may require a separate padded liner or bib short for long-distance comfort on the saddle.

Do these shorts come with a chamois pad?

No, the Madison Roam shorts do not include an integrated liner or chamois pad.

Can I wear these for activities other than mountain biking?

Yes, their casual aesthetic and technical fabric make them suitable for hiking, camping, or everyday casual wear.

How should I wash them?

Wash on a cool cycle without fabric softener and air dry to maintain the fabric properties.

Are the pockets large enough for modern smartphones?

Yes, they feature a dedicated hidden pocket sized specifically to accommodate modern smartphones securely.

Is there a warranty?

Yes, this product includes a limited lifetime warranty.

Does the waistband contain elastic?

The fit is managed via an integrated webbed belt system rather than traditional elastic, allowing for a more customized, low-profile fit.

Troubleshooting

Shorts sliding down during rides

Tighten the integrated webbed belt using the metal adjuster and ensure the silicone grip print is clean and in contact with your base layer.

Water soaking into the fabric

The DWR coating may have worn off; use a technical garment re-proofer spray to restore the water-repellent properties.

Difficulty accessing phone pocket

Ensure the zipper track is kept clean of mud or debris to maintain smooth operation.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

For optimal performance, ensure the integrated webbed belt is cinched to your preference before starting your ride to prevent movement during technical sections. These shorts are compatible with any standard MTB liner or chamois short if extra cushioning is desired. When caring for the garment, machine wash on a cold cycle to protect the integrity of the technical fabric and the DWR coating. Avoid fabric softeners, as they can clog the pores of the material and reduce breathability. Air drying is highly recommended to extend the lifespan of the synthetic fibers and the silicone grip print inside the waistband.
